Has anyone actually purchased/used a sippy cup?

I was just wondering if anyone has actually purchased/used a sippy cup while in the post op phase? Just a curiosity that i have since sipping is the only thing allowed.

Yep!! I have four sippy cups and I love them. Three are the six ounce size and one is the ten ounce size. I use them at University and don't care if anyone stares :-)!!! They actually help get Protein shakes down faster because I can't "smell" what's in the cup and I'm the cup it doesn't feel like such a big task. Also I can shake them if stuff separates. Love them.

I purchased two of them yesterday. Playtex Coolster, twist and click with a leak proof seal. It holds 10 oz and it's insulated. One is blue with a grey top, and the other is pink with a neon green top. Although it says 12+ (indicating safe for 12 month olds.. LOL), it doesn't look like a baby's cup. I figured I'd get one for water, and one for protein drinks / soup. I haven't tried it yet, I'm waiting to start my liquid diet.
